在Debian系統中,通常使用apt
包管理器來安裝、更新和刪除軟件包,而不是yum
。yum
是Red Hat系列發行版(如Fedora、CentOS)的包管理器。如果你是在Debian系統上操作,應該使用apt
相關的命令。
如果你想要備份Debian系統上的重要數據,可以使用以下步驟:
創建一個備份計劃:
使用rsync
進行文件備份:
rsync
是一個非常強大的文件復制工具,它可以用來同步文件和目錄,并且只復制有變化的部分,節省時間和帶寬。
例如,要備份/home/user/documents
目錄到外部硬盤/mnt/backup
,你可以使用以下命令:
rsync -av --delete /home/user/documents /mnt/backup/documents
這個命令會遞歸地復制documents
目錄下的所有文件和子目錄到備份位置,并且在下次運行時會刪除目標目錄中存在而源目錄中不存在的文件,以保持備份的一致性。
備份配置文件:
重要的配置文件通常位于/etc
目錄下。你可以使用rsync
來備份整個/etc
目錄或者特定的配置文件。
rsync -av /etc /mnt/backup/etc
備份數據庫: 如果你有數據庫服務(如MySQL、PostgreSQL),你需要使用相應的數據庫備份工具來備份數據庫。
例如,對于MySQL,你可以使用mysqldump
:
mysqldump -u [username] -p[password] [database_name] > /mnt/backup/database_name.sql
自動化備份:
你可以使用cron
作業來自動化備份過程。編輯用戶的crontab
文件:
crontab -e
然后添加一行來定義備份任務,例如每天凌晨1點執行備份:
0 1 * * * rsync -av --delete /home/user/documents /mnt/backup/documents
0 1 * * * rsync -av /etc /mnt/backup/etc
測試備份: 定期檢查備份文件的完整性,并測試恢復過程以確保備份是有效的。
請記住,備份策略應該根據你的具體需求來定制。確保你的備份是安全的,并且有適當的訪問控制,以防止未授權的訪問。此外,考慮使用加密來保護備份數據,特別是在存儲或傳輸過程中。